After retrieving the data (Jan 1, 1979 to Dec 31, 2018) from CDS, I have in the input file 24 houly steps (0, 1, 2, 3, 4,..,23) for each calendar day starting from Jan 1 to Dec 31 of each considered year.
As far as I know and from the post mentioned (ERA5: how to calculate daily total precipitation:ERA5: How to calculate daily total precipitation) the accumulated precipitation for Jan 1, 1979 is obtained by summing the steps 1, 2,...,23 of Jan 1 and step 0 of Jan 2. It means that the step 0 of Jan 1, 1979 is not included in calculation of the total precipitation for that day. For calculation of total precipitation for Jan 2, 1979 we use also the steps 1, 2, 3,...,23 of that day plus step 0 of Jan 3 and so on.
I am doing all the operations through CDO operators as ilustrated bellow:
cdo -f nc copy out.nc aux.nc
cdo -delete,timestep=1, aux.nc aux1.nc
cdo -b 32 timselsum,24 aux1.nc aux2.nc
cdo -expr,'ppt=tp*1000' -setmissval,-9999.9 -remapbil,r240x120 aux2.nc era5_ppt_prev-0_1979-2018.nc
The problem raises for Dec 31 of last year (2018) in may sample as I have not retrieved the step 0 of Jan 1, 2019 which should be used in calculation of total precipitation for Dec 31 according to explanation above.
